Wehrden Castle is an impressive baroque complex with a main building and several auxiliary buildings. In place of a previous building, the castle was built in 1696-1699 by the then Paderborn Prince-Bishop Hermann Werner von Wolff-Metternich zur Gracht as a summer residence and has been in the possession of the Barons von Wolff-Metternich without interruption ever since. A tour is not possible, the courtyard can be entered.

The publicly accessible, so-called "New Park" is located on the Weser side of Wehrden Castle. You can also look at the Droste tower and you are right on the Weser promenade.
